Output d8d7aaa5aed1667620a91d5d0ccf247bf1cd275ea17d02fe4bb16e0864a04555:3

value
6511650
script pubkey
OP_0 OP_PUSHBYTES_20 d003c25abaa8e8073d30149c3c3b48574cb88833
address
bc1q6qpuyk464r5qw0fszjwrcw6g2axt3zpnek72me
transaction
d8d7aaa5aed1667620a91d5d0ccf247bf1cd275ea17d02fe4bb16e0864a04555
spent
true